It's sad to see that HGVC often has orphaned days that cannot be booked due to the 3 night minimum. Look at the 3 studios available in the screenshot below @ Marbrisa. It's available for 4 out of the 5 nights I need but I can't book them.

Is there any work around?

If you are within Open Season you can book them for cash because that's a 2 night min.
